Students Die By Suicide In Karnataka After Failing Second PUC Examination; Over 5 Such Cases Reported

The results for the second Karnataka examination were announced on April 8, with an approval rate or 73.45 percent. Unfortunately, the announcement has led to tragic results, since several students who did not approve have tasks of their own lives. In several state districts, more than five students have committed suicide due to the failures of their exams.

In a heartbreaking incident, Roopashree, 18, from the village of Ramayannalyaa in Doddaballapur, ended his life jumping to a well. Roopashree, who had been living in his grandmother’s house, was deeply distressed by his results. The Doddaballapur Rural Police Station has registered a case after the recovery of its body.

Other districts have also witnessed similar tragedies. Kavya Basappa Lamani, a student of the Hansabavi Police Station in Haveri, touched his own life after failing the second PU exam.

In the Mysore district, Aishwarya, a student from a government university in Ontikoppal, also committed suicide. Vijayalakshmi sirupada ended his life in Agasanur, Siraguppa Taluk or Bellary district.

In addition, a student named Kruupa, who studied science at a private university in Davangere, played his own life after reproving the exam. In Bengaluru, another student committed suicide only a few hours before the results were announced.

The authorities urge students not to resort to such extreme measures, reminding them that there are additional opportunities to resume exams. Free arrangements have the leg so that students feel for the second and third attempt, and it is crucial to face the exams without fear.
